Origins of the Paper Cup Industry – Two Versions

Paper cup production hardly blossomed overnight in either country. Paper cups have been a fixture in the United States since the early 1900s with demand growing for sanitary, disposable cups in workplaces and public places. The market evolved over the decades, embracing high end automation, custom printing technologies, and a relentless focus on brand experience.

India’s tale, however, began even more recently. As tea stalls, quick service restaurant chains have mushroomed and consumers are growing conscious about the environment, India’s paper cup industry scaled up rapidly, offering cheap customisation and penetrating both rural and urban markets.

Scale of Production, Cost and Supply Chain Dynamics

It is impossible to talk about paper cup production India vs USA without pulling in to focus on the element of cost structures and the strength of the supply chain.

India cannot survive on boutique, high-cost production models. Custom solutions are offered with competitive pricing utilizing labor intensive manufacturing processes. Furthermore, given India’s geographical location, it can also serve as a convenient supplier to emerging markets in Asia, Africa and the Middle East.

The USA is costly in labour and material, but has precision manufacturing supported by the most advanced technology and automation. But global supply chain changes after the pandemic have made these distinctions blurry. Today, an increasing number of US companies pursue associations with Indian paper cup company in pursuit of an optimal cost-quality-sustainability formula.

The Eco-Revolution: Who’s in the Lead?

As the world speeds toward zero-waste aspirations, biodegradable paper cup producers in both nations have taken notice. The momentum towards plant-based solutions and compostable standards in the USA is tremendous and shows the way for global best practice.

In India, meanwhile, sustainability is fast becoming democratized thanks to the fact that even your street corner chai stand is able to offer eco-friendlier alternatives. Local innovations such as cups from bagasse or areca leaf liners are drawing international attention for their resourcefulness.
